Nestled along the Hudson River, Ossining is a quiet town with scenic riverside views and a wealth of natural landscape.
The real estate market is dynamic, with an increase in new development along the town’s waterfront. Its proximity to New York City makes it a favorite home base for commuters. The market comprises of single family homes and spacious condos and amenity-rich apartments. An affluent corner of Westchester, the prices in Ossining are high due to its amenity-rich surroundings and easy access to Manhattan. The terrain is significantly hilly, which makes it a bit difficult to consider the area genuinely walkable. Ossining more than makes up for it with a wealth of parkland featuring hiking and biking trails.
The historical region boasts pockets of retail full of trendy coffee shops, upscale restaurants, and craft beer bars. Happy hour friendly, many of the bars and pubs in the area offer live music and delicious appetizers. The area’s important artist community means there’s always a new gallery opening, concert, or play to attend. In addition to a lively yet laid-back nightlife, residents also have access to a variety of family-friendly activities like athletic clubs and playgrounds.
